Design is a political act / Anne Stenros / Episode #38
Anne Stenros is the Chief Design Officer for the city of Helsinki in Finland. In this episode she talks about her role, the future of cities and why design is by definition always an political act.

What it means for service design to grow up / Louise Downe / Episode #36
New challenges emerge as service design is growing up. The Head of Service Design at the UK government, Louise Downe, talks about how we can sustainable scale service design on an organisational level. And why we need to reconsider the role of service designers in general.

Design is very simple / Hartmut Esslinger / Episode #35
Hartmut Esslinger has been a designer since the age of 5. Today he is still concerned with how we can design better instead of more products. Design for reuse, modularity and sustainability. And we also talk about how education needs to change radically.
